Cardiology is a medical speciality and a branch of internal medicine concerned with disorders of the HEART. It deals with the diagnosis and treatment of such conditions as congenital heart disease, heart defect, coronary artery disease, electrophysiology, heart failure and valvular heart disease. Cardiology is a branch of medicine that focuses on the diagnosis, prevention, and management of conditions affecting the heart and blood vessels. A heart specialist evaluates symptoms that may be related to cardiac health and helps patients understand their condition clearly.

Every patient may experience symptoms differently. Some people may notice chest pain or pressure, while others may experience tiredness, dizziness, shortness of breath, swelling in the legs, or a fast or irregular heartbeat. A detailed consultation helps identify whether further evaluation is required.

High blood pressure, also known as hypertension, is one of the most common health conditions affecting adults. It may not always cause noticeable symptoms, but uncontrolled blood pressure can increase the risk of heart disease, stroke, and kidney-related problems. Regular monitoring, medical advice, lifestyle changes, and prescribed treatment can help manage blood pressure effectively.
Coronary artery disease occurs when blood flow to the heart is affected due to narrowing or blockage in the blood vessels. It may cause chest pain, discomfort, breathlessness, or fatigue. A heart specialist can assess symptoms, review risk factors, and guide patients regarding evaluation and further treatment planning.
A heart attack is a medical emergency. Sudden chest pressure, severe discomfort, sweating, breathlessness, nausea, or pain spreading to the arm, jaw, shoulder, or back requires immediate medical attention.
Heart failure does not mean that the heart has stopped working. It means the heart may not be pumping blood as efficiently as it should. Symptoms can include breathlessness, weakness, swelling in the feet or ankles, and tiredness during routine activities. Early assessment and regular follow-up can help manage the condition and support a better quality of life.
Arrhythmias are irregular heartbeats. Some people may feel palpitations, a racing heartbeat, skipped beats, dizziness, or weakness. While not every irregular heartbeat is serious, it is important to consult a heart specialist if symptoms occur repeatedly or are associated with chest discomfort, fainting, or breathlessness.
Rheumatic heart disease can affect the heart valves and may develop after rheumatic fever. Proper assessment, follow-up, and treatment planning are important for patients with known valve-related or rheumatic heart conditions.
